Output 5191ee1c15acaca94bde106d38d1fe50f2ca90f74ac9e330c19c62df47c2c69b:1

value
1062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d77a18e11f1298e13b1e754412f36a30e543a55 OP_EQUAL
address
34NpqDgvzmUHyjPm75RuFNXcEDXvcrVgdw
transaction
5191ee1c15acaca94bde106d38d1fe50f2ca90f74ac9e330c19c62df47c2c69b
confirmations
224998
spent
true